Ordinals
beta
Sat 198387430148091
decimal
39677.2430148091
degree
0°39677′1373″2430148091‴
percentile
9.447020493634156%
name
mlfdcvdqkpa
cycle
0
epoch
0
period
19
block
39677
offset
2430148091
timestamp
2010-02-11 21:43:21 UTC
rarity
common
prev
next